For the occasion, the Ministry of Education and the Ministry of Family Affairs joined forces and signed a new deal to empower young people to make a better use of the internet, and to recognise potential signs of danger. The two ministries have launched an awareness-raising video campaign against cyberbullying.
Along with the institutions, many high profile Italian YouTubers and Creators took part in the event, to demonstrate the positive use of the internet. The Italian SIC engaged students and teachers by facilitating constructive dialogue through an online survey, and its experts answered questions, helping students to learn how to be safe online.
